CONSTRUCTION FOR “MAKER SPACE” HAS BEGUN

The Chico branch library’s Maker Space has begun to take shape in the center of the library’s main room.  Your CFOL will make significant contributions to this new resource.  Devices such as 3-D printers, a button maker, sewing machines, typewriters, and an Ellison die-cut machine will be available for public use.  There will also be space for tutoring, book discussions, Fandom Club, computer lab and other programs.  Your CFOL will purchase materials as well as storage cabinets and work surfaces, while Butte County is constructing the surrounding walls.  Talk to library staff to share your ideas for additional devices and programs.

In the meantime, come to the library for a demonstration and hands-on experience with the Chico branch’s new Virtual Reality equipment!  Demonstrations will be held on Tuesdays from 12:30 to 2:00 p.m.  While the initial VR equipment was purchased with a grant, your CFOL provides additional funding for software and accessories.

DEPARTURES

Brenda Crotts, Chico library branch manager, will retire from her forty years of Butte County service at the end of January.  Brenda has overseen extensive rearrangement of the library’s materials and displays as well as implementation of innovative new programs and services.

Barbara Seawall, longtime library advocate and book sale manager/supporter, passed away in December.  Her devotion to the Chico branch library continues on with a portion of her estate bequeathed to the Chico Friends of t he Library.
